The Aeropuerto Internacional Lic. Gustavo Díaz Ordaz, also known as Puerto Vallarta International Airport, is located in Puerto Vallarta, Mexico. It serves as a crucial gateway for tourists visiting the popular resort city located on the Pacific coast.
This airport is named after Licenciado Gustavo Díaz Ordaz, a former Mexican president. It is a modern and efficient facility that handles both domestic and international flights, connecting Puerto Vallarta to various destinations around the world.
The airport features a single runway and a terminal building that has been expanded and renovated to accommodate the growing number of passengers. It offers a range of services and am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ience for passengers.
Passengers arriving at the Aeropuerto Internacional Lic. Gustavo Díaz Ordaz can easily access transportation options such as taxis, rental cars, and shuttle services to reach their final destinations in Puerto Vallarta and beyond.
